Overview:  

 

The ATS family of 6U VME Discrete I/O modules are designed to provide users with a high degree of reliability and flexibility to meet input-output requirements. The ATS-VME-DIO boards provide an economical method for isolation and interfacing of I/O signals to the VME bus. Optical-relays, which are built-in, are provided for each I/O channel. These eliminate the expenses incurred due to the usage of external relay panels. They are ideally suited for stringent military and airborne applications. On-board relays isolate all the inputs, outputs and the VMEbus from each other against all sorts of transients emanating from ground loops etc. The ATS-VME-DIO provides 16 or 32 channels of isolated inputs and 16 or 32  channels of isolated outputs. The voltage levels supported are TTL and Open Collector voltages. Also available on the board are 2 serial asynchronous RS-422 channels. These have a programmable baud rate up to 115.2 k/Bauds.
 
       

 

Hardware:

The ATS-VME-DIO boards meet the VME 64x standard and are available in a 6U form factor. The boards are available in three variants – Commercial, Air-Cooled and Conduction Cooled versions. It is designed to work in units meeting MIL-STD-461C for EMI/EMC and MIL-STD-810E for airborne applications.  

All the components used are MIL qualified as per MIL-STD 883B/C in the conduction cooled version. 

Front panel and Rear I/O connectivity options are provided for commercial and air-cooled boards. Conduction cooled boards are available with Rear I/O connectivity only.

  Virtual Instrument Panel 
The ATS-VME-DIO card comes with a “Virtual Instrument Panel” providing interactive control of all
interactive control of Discrete I/O and UART features. The control interface appears on the computer display and user manipulates these controls with a mouse or keyboard. The purpose of Virtual Instrument Panel is to help the user (mostly system integrators) to quickly setup and use the card, just like a stand-alone instrument with physical front-end knobs, controls and display without getting into programming intricacies 

Drivers & APIs
 
The ATS-VME-DIO card comes with a powerful set of library functions to access the entire card functionality. The drivers are designed in a modular fashion consisting of component functions and application functions. The user’s test program can be developed with few calls to the driver, by using the set of Application functions provided. 

Driver and high-level API libraries for Windows 98/2000/NT/XP, Linux & RT-Linux, VxWorks 5.5, LynxOS 4.0 are available. Sample applications are included.
